Note that most apparatus for this test hold the cable under tension, which will assist in straighteningthe cable specimen. The duct specimen is shorter than the cable specimen. Straightening of the duct specimen andashortlengthofthespecimenisrequiredtoachieveaspecimenthatissubstantially dov straight.Takecarethatthelengthof the ductspecimenis short enoughbut notso short as to fail to lay flat on the cable specimen during the test. The (intrinsic) bend radius of the duct shall not result in opposite walls touching the cable, which would result in extra friction due to the spring action of the duct ends. A mass, typically cylindrical and surrounding the duct, may 9 beattached to theduct specimento simulate theeffects of upstreamfrictionof a lengthof duct and cable. Longer duct lengths are possible when using a straight (metal) cylinder around the duct specimen, which at the same time serves as a weight. The total weight of duct specimen and cylinder per unit of length shall be between 1 and 10 times the weight of the cable specimen per unit of length. The ends of the duct specimen may be treated with a conical drill or a similar tool, such that the cable is only in contact with the inner surface of the duct. Before finishing clamping the cable specimen a short specimen of duct is repr sleeved around it, see 3.3.2. The tension of the cable specimen in the fixture must be large enoughtostraightenthecablespecimensufficientlysuchthatthedeviationofthecablefrom tion a straight line is minimised (see the discussion in 3.3.2). The deviation is typically less than O.5° which can be estimated by visual examination; if in doubt it should be measured. The clamping device with specimens can be tilted with respect to the horizontal.
